In this article, we will provide you with all the information you need to know about Semana Santa 2023 in Peru. What is Semana Santa? Semana Santa is a week-long celebration that commemorates the passion, death, and resurrection of Jesus Christ. The week begins with Palm Sunday, which marks Jesus' triumphal entry into Jerusalem, and ends with Easter Sunday, which celebrates his resurrection. In Peru, Semana Santa is a time for religious observances, processions, and family gatherings. When is Semana Santa 2023 in Peru? Peruvians celebrate Semana Santa in different ways depending on where they live. In some cities, such as Ayacucho and Cusco, there are large processions that attract thousands of people. In Lima, many people attend religious services and spend time with their families. Some people also take the opportunity to travel to other parts of the country during the week. What are some popular Semana Santa destinations in Peru? If you are planning to travel to Peru during Semana Santa, there are several places you may want to consider visiting. Ayacucho is known for its elaborate processions and is considered the spiritual capital of Peru during Holy Week. Cusco is another popular destination, with processions that feature traditional dances and costumes. Lima is also a great place to experience Semana Santa, with many churches and cathedrals holding special services throughout the week.
